dream321
青学不精
级别: 家园常客
精华主题: 0
发帖数量: 363 个
工控威望: 556 点
下载积分: 5946 分
在线时间: 357(小时)
注册时间: 2012-03-07
最后登录: 2024-11-22
查看dream321的 主题 / 回贴
楼主  发表于: 2017-01-23 22:45
信捷PLC浮点数乘法,其结果可以只要整数部分吗,不要小数点后面的数字。EMUL K0.23  K33 D10   只等于7就好了,不要后面的数字。
jicjic111
进步
级别: 略有小成
精华主题: 0
发帖数量: 220 个
工控威望: 377 点
下载积分: 911 分
在线时间: 375(小时)
注册时间: 2013-05-30
最后登录: 2024-11-10
查看jicjic111的 主题 / 回贴
1楼  发表于: 2017-01-24 08:27
再转换一下,浮点数转成整数不是就可以了吗
楼主留言:
谢谢,学艺不精,谢谢老师指教
jsnj887
级别: 探索解密
精华主题: 0
发帖数量: 21 个
工控威望: 111 点
下载积分: 430 分
在线时间: 20(小时)
注册时间: 2016-07-22
最后登录: 2024-11-22
查看jsnj887的 主题 / 回贴
2楼  发表于: 2017-01-24 09:56
浮点数是32位的,你取其中的16位就行了,d10和D11分别存储的是整数和小数。。。
楼主留言:
真的是你说的那样吗,下午用信捷试试,谢谢指导
weisongyuan
永远年轻
级别: 网络英雄
精华主题: 0
发帖数量: 581 个
工控威望: 10117 点
下载积分: 1951 分
在线时间: 479(小时)
注册时间: 2013-08-13
最后登录: 2024-11-22
查看weisongyuan的 主题 / 回贴
3楼  发表于: 2017-01-29 19:30
PLC都有数据类型转换指令  用相应的指令转换就是了
永远年轻